  • Page 2 The safety of any system incorporating this product is the responsibility of the assembler of the system. Do not install Cognex products where they are exposed to environmental hazards such as excessive heat, dust, moisture, humidity, impact, vibration, corrosive substances, flammable substances, or static electricity.
  • Page 3 Ensure that the cable bend radius begins at least six inches from the connector. Cable shielding can be degraded or cables can be damaged or wear out faster if a service loop or bend radius is tighter than 10X the cable diameter.

  • Page 16 Working Distance Horizontal FOV Vertical FOV Maximum 700 mm (27.56 in) 126 mm (4.96 in) 94.5 mm (3.72 in) Mounting the Vision Sensor CAUTION: The vision sensor has to be grounded, either by mounting the vision sensor to a fixture that is electrically grounded or by attaching a wire from the vision sensor’s mounting fixture to frame ground or Earth ground.
  • Page 17 2. Insert the screws. Note: The vision sensor has two sets of threaded holes for mounting. Use only one set depending on the best configuration for your application. For the threaded holes closer to the front of the vision sensor you need M3X5 screws, for those closer to the connectors M3X9.
  • Page 18 3. If needed, you can rotate the mounting bracket up to 45 degrees. To do so, loosen the screw in the curved slot. Note: Mounting the vision sensor at a slight, 15 degree angle reduces reflections and improves performance.

    Connecting the Ethernet Cable CAUTION: The Ethernet cable shield has to be grounded at the far end. Whatever this cable is plugged into (typically a switch or router) should have a grounded Ethernet connector. A digital voltmeter has to be used to validate the grounding.
  • Page 20 Connecting the Power and I/O Breakout Cable CAUTION: To reduce emissions, connect the far end of the Breakout cable shield to frame ground. Note: Perform wiring or adjustments to I/O devices when the vision sensor is not receiving power. You can clip unused wires short or use a tie made of non-conductive material to tie them back.
